I started by sorting out a couple of things with car that bugged me a bit starting with the yellow headlights.
before
i started with 600 wet dry paper with soapy water and worked my way up to 2000 changing direction each time i changed grade and finished them off with some t-cut scratch remover and some marine finishing compound on a machine polisher from someone i know that works on yachts, it came out better than i expected.

Now i needed some stretch to keep that tread under the arch so i got straight on the internet and ordered some nankangs
165/50/15 for the 8's on the front
And 185/45/15 for the 9's on the rear
